What is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market?
The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market is a significant segment within the broader coatings industry, characterized by its specialized formulation and application. These coatings are composed of two separate components that must be mixed before application, typically consisting of a resin and a hardener. This unique composition allows for enhanced durability, chemical resistance, and a superior finish, making them ideal for industrial applications where performance and longevity are critical. The market for these coatings is driven by their widespread use in industries such as automotive, construction, and electronics, where they provide essential protective and aesthetic functions. Chemical Cross-Linking Type, Physical Curing Type in the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market:
In the realm of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ings, two primary types of curing processes are prevalent: Chemical Cross-Linking and Physical Curing. Chemical Cross-Linking involves a chemical reaction between the resin and hardener components, resulting in a robust, interlinked molecular structure. This process is crucial for achieving the high-performance characteristics that two-pack coatings are known for, such as enhanced durability, chemical resistance, and adhesion. The cross-linking process ensures that the coating forms a strong, cohesive film that can withstand harsh environmental conditions and mechanical stress. This type of curing is particularly beneficial in applications where the coating is exposed to chemicals, abrasion, or extreme temperatures, making it a preferred choice in industries like automotive and construction. On the other hand, Physical Curing relies on the evaporation of solvents or water to form a solid film. This process is generally faster and less complex than chemical cross-linking, but it may not provide the same level of performance in terms of durability and resistance. Physical curing is often used in applications where quick drying times are essential, or where the environmental conditions do not demand the highest levels of protection. However, advancements in technology have led to the development of hybrid systems that combine elements of both chemical and physical curing, offering a balance between performance and practicality. These hybrid systems are gaining popularity as they provide the benefits of both curing methods, catering to a wider range of industrial needs. The choice between chemical cross-linking and physical curing depends largely on the specific requirements of the application, including the desired performance characteristics, environmental conditions, and cost considerations. Automotive, Construction, Electronics, Other in the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market:
The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market finds extensive application across various sectors, including automotive, construction, electronics, and others. In the automotive industry, these coatings are essential for providing a durable and aesthetically pleasing finish to vehicles. They offer superior protection against corrosion, UV radiation, and mechanical wear, ensuring that vehicles maintain their appearance and structural integrity over time. The high-performance characteristics of two-pack coatings make them ideal for use on both the exterior and interior surfaces of vehicles, where they must withstand harsh environmental conditions and frequent use. In the construction industry, two-pack coatings are used to protect and enhance the appearance of buildings and infrastructure. They provide a robust barrier against environmental factors such as moisture, chemicals, and UV radiation, which can cause deterioration and reduce the lifespan of structures. These coatings are commonly applied to surfaces such as steel, concrete, and wood, where they offer long-lasting protection and improve the aesthetic appeal of buildings. In the electronics sector, two-pack coatings are used to protect sensitive components from moisture, dust, and other contaminants. They provide a protective layer that ensures the reliable performance of electronic devices, even in challenging environments. The coatings are often applied to circuit boards, connectors, and other critical components, where they help prevent corrosion and electrical failures. Beyond these primary sectors, two-pack coatings are also used in a variety of other applications, including marine, aerospace, and industrial equipment. In the marine industry, they provide essential protection against the corrosive effects of saltwater and harsh weather conditions, ensuring the longevity of ships and offshore structures. In aerospace, two-pack coatings are used to protect aircraft components from extreme temperatures and environmental stressors, contributing to the safety and reliability of air travel. In industrial settings, these coatings are applied to machinery and equipment to prevent wear and extend their operational life.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market Outlook:
The outlook for the Global Industrial Two-Pack Coatings Market is promising, with significant growth anticipated over the coming years. In 2024, the market was valued at approximately $7,563 million, reflecting its substantial presence in the coatings industry. Looking ahead, the market is projected to expand to a revised size of $11,100 million by 2031, indicating a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% during the forecast period. This growth is driven by several factors, including the increasing demand for high-performance coatings in various industries, advancements in coating technologies, and the growing emphasis on sustainability and environmental responsibility.
